The Vietnam Licensed Merchandise Market was estimated at USD 716 Million in 2025 and is projected to reach USD 1017 Million by 2032, growing at a CAGR of 5.1% from 2026 to 2032. This growth trajectory is propelled by the increasing demand for branded products and the popularity of franchises in Vietnam. Consumers are increasingly drawn to the authenticity and quality associated with licensed merchandise, creating a fertile ground for local and international brands to thrive.

The landscape of the Vietnam Licensed Merchandise Market is rapidly evolving, reflecting a shift in consumer preferences toward branded products. Licensing agreements are becoming commonplace, with a notable increase in items tied to popular characters, franchises, and sports teams, catering to diverse demographics.
A blend of brand loyalty, cultural trends, and expanding e-commerce avenues fuels this market's growth. Consumers now look for unique, quality products that resonate with their interests, enabling the market to flourish as manufacturers innovate and diversify their offerings.
The Vietnam Licensed Merchandise Market faces substantial restraints that can hinder its potential. Navigating the intricate landscape of licensing agreements and intellectual property rights presents significant challenges for manufacturers. The time and resources required for compliance can be burdensome, especially for smaller entities. Additionally, the ever-changing preferences of consumers necessitate rapid adaptation in product offerings, which can strain operational capabilities. Economic fluctuations and competitive pressures further complicate the landscape, as brands must continually innovate to capture and retain consumer interest.
Current trends in the Vietnam Licensed Merchandise Market reflect a shift toward digital engagement and innovative marketing strategies. With the rise of e-commerce, brands are increasingly leveraging online platforms to reach younger, tech-savvy consumers. Moreover, collaborations with popular influencers and content creators are becoming a popular avenue for enhancing brand visibility and engagement. Sustainability is also gaining traction, with consumers showing preference for eco-friendly licensed products, pushing manufacturers to adapt accordingly.
As the Vietnam Licensed Merchandise Market grows, numerous opportunities are emerging for savvy investors. Expanding into untapped demographics, particularly younger consumers, offers vast potential. The surge in online shopping opens new avenues for reaching audiences beyond traditional retail channels. Brands that successfully leverage localized content and culturally relevant products can capitalize on the evolving consumer landscape. Additionally, there is considerable room for growth in sectors such as sports merchandise, which remains underexplored compared to more established franchises.
The Vietnamese government is actively promoting initiatives to boost the licensed merchandise sector, recognizing its potential for economic growth. Policies aimed at protecting intellectual property rights are being strengthened to combat counterfeiting and ensure fair competition. Furthermore, public spending on cultural projects and events can create additional opportunities for licensed merchandise tied to local and international franchises. Support for e-commerce development is also a focal point, facilitating easier access for brands to enter the market and reach consumers effectively.
Looking ahead to 2026-2032, the Vietnam Licensed Merchandise Market is poised for transformative growth driven by continued consumer enthusiasm for branded products. As e-commerce continues to gain traction, companies that adapt to digital marketing trends and focus on innovative product offerings will likely lead the charge. The integration of technology, such as augmented reality experiences in marketing campaigns, may further enhance consumer engagement. Moreover, sustainability and ethical sourcing will become increasingly important as consumers demand transparency and accountability from brands.
Recent developments in the Vietnam Licensed Merchandise Market indicate a strategic pivot towards digital-first approaches. Brands are focusing on strengthening their online presence, investing in e-commerce solutions and digital marketing campaigns. Collaborations with local influencers are increasingly popular, enhancing brand visibility and consumer interaction. Additionally, several high-profile licensing agreements have been established, aimed at expanding product ranges and tapping into diverse consumer interests, further solidifying the market's growth potential.

Export potential enables firms to identify high-growth global markets with greater confidence by combining advanced trade intelligence with a structured quantitative methodology. The framework analyzes emerging demand trends and country-level import patterns while integrating macroeconomic and trade datasets such as GDP and population forecasts, bilateral import–export flows, tariff structures, elasticity differentials between developed and developing economies, geographic distance, and import demand projections. Using weighted trade values from 2020–2024 as the base period to project country-to-country export potential for 2030, these inputs are operationalized through calculated drivers such as gravity model parameters, tariff impact factors, and projected GDP per-capita growth. Through an analysis of hidden potentials, demand hotspots, and market conditions that are most favorable to success, this method enables firms to focus on target countries, maximize returns, and global expansion with data, backed by accuracy.
By factoring in the projected importer demand gap that is currently unmet and could be potential opportunity, it identifies the potential for the Exporter (Country) among 190 countries, against the general trade analysis, which identifies the biggest importer or exporter.
